A major UK casino operator seeks a skilled HR Business Partner experienced within retail and hospitality sectors. This role will partner with leadership to develop effective HR strategies that meet business objectives, engage employees, and enhance performance.

Qualifications include:

  • Extensive HR experience
  • Employment law knowledge
  • Solid skills in relationship building
  • A CIPD certification is desirable

A hybrid working model may be available.

How to prepare for a job interview at Grosvenor Casinos Limited

Know Your HR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your HR knowledge, especially in retail and hospitality. Be ready to discuss how you've successfully implemented HR strategies in similar environments and how they aligned with business objectives.

Showcase Your Relationship-Building Skills

Prepare examples that highlight your ability to build strong relationships with leadership and employees. Think of specific situations where your interpersonal skills made a difference in employee engagement or performance.

Understand Employment Law

Since employment law knowledge is crucial for this role, be prepared to discuss relevant legislation and how it impacts HR practices. You might even want to bring up recent changes in the law that could affect the retail and hospitality sectors.

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t shy away from asking questions. Inquire about the company's HR strategies, challenges they face in the multi-site environment, or how they measure employee engagement. This shows your genuine interest and strategic thinking.
